Mercury’s latest 3U and 6U OpenVPX modules support the development of Electronic Warfare/Signals Intelligence (EW/SIGINT) applications. The modules combine multiple technologies used in systems to detect, deceive, and defeat electronic transmissions from opposing forces in missions ranging from radar targeting suppression to counter-IED. Two 3U OpenVPX modules support EW/SIGINT functionality on platforms with limited size, weight, and power budgets. The Ensemble HCD3210 processing module combines a Virtex-6 FPGA with a Freescale dual-core 8640D general purpose processor. The Ensemble SFM3010 multi-plane switching module supports a low-latency, deterministic SRIO fabric data plane, a GigE switching control plane, and an IPMI-based system management plane. Larger 6U OpenVPX subsystems include the Echotek Series SCFE-V6-OVPX module that supports three Virtex-6 FPGAs, two VITA-57 FMC sites, and a Linux-based control processor.
